Setting up and running of semi-automated plastic moulding machines. Meeting planning schedule requirements. Responsible for managing colour and label changeover. Operation of case & pallet shrink wrappers and label printers in a hygienic and safe manner. Palletisation of cases in specific pallet configurations as per company procedures. Complete quality checks accurately and in full. Troubleshooting of machine issues as they arise. Liaise with Engineering team as required. General hygiene tasks in the area ensuring the company's 'clean as you go' procedure is adhered to at all times. Complete the operator training plan to ensure an understanding of the moulding process and a good understanding of the machinery involved. Operator asset care duties with general maintenance of moulding area machinery and equipment.
